In this Drumma Boy-produced remix (Kanye, not Jay-Z, was on the original), Jeezy and Jay-Z make one thing clear: They “Put On” for their city! (Jeezy puts on for Atlanta and Jay-Z for New York, specifically Brooklyn)

“Putting on” can mean estimably representing one’s city, doing charitable acts, or watching out for the well-being of the people from your neighborhood

Jay-Z and Young Jeezy collaborate well, including in “As Real as it Gets” on Jay’s latest, Blueprint 3
